Well I am in the home stretch! The motor is back and almost fully assembled and the trans @ jimmys trans. Motor, 20 over crank, 30 on the pistons, K1 rods, dimond pistons fully balanced. cam 212/214 TE61 turbo, 7.3 front mount intercooler fully ported heads 60# injectors. What should I set the shift point @. or should I wait to see how the boost responds? any suggestions on what to spin this thing up to? I think I was @ 43 to 4600 before. thanks in advace.
 
I would wait until you see how the motor runs with the current setup first. With that cam I would think something in the 5200-5300 rpm range would work nicely.
 
Around 5500. I shift at 5800 and it goes to 5600+ at the end.
